Easy hiking trails in Cantabria traverse a diverse landscape, from the towering peaks of the Picos de Europa to lush valleys and a dramatic coastline. The region features extensive networks of trails through dense forests, along river courses, and across coastal dunes. This varied terrain offers numerous opportunities for outdoor exploration, with elevations ranging from sea level to significant mountain ascents.

The Bolao Cliff is a stunning natural setting on the coast of Cantabria, Spain, between Cóbreces and Toñanes. It is famous for the El Bolao waterfall, which falls directly into the sea, and for the ruins of a medieval mill. The landscape combines the green meadows with the rugged Cantabrian Sea coast, offering spectacular views.

The old town of San Vicente de la Barquera and the Maza Bridge are two of the main tourist attractions of this picturesque fishing village in Cantabria. This historic center dates back to medieval times and is located in a privileged natural setting within the Oyambre Natural Park.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many easy hiking trails are available in Cantabria?

Cantabria boasts a wide selection of easy hiking trails, with over 600 routes specifically categorized as easy. This allows for diverse exploration across the region's varied landscapes.

What do other hikers enjoy most about the easy trails in Cantabria?

The easy trails in Cantabria are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.4 stars from over 7700 reviews. Hikers often praise the diverse scenery, from coastal paths to lush river valleys, and the accessibility of these routes for all skill levels.

Are there any easy circular walks in Cantabria?

Yes, Cantabria offers several easy circular walks. For example, the San Vicente de la Barquera – circular from Playa La Espina is a great option, offering coastal views and a manageable distance. Another popular choice is the Playa de Robayera - Playa de Usgo – circular by the Marisma de Miengo, which takes you through marshlands and along the coast.

Can I find easy trails that are suitable for families in Cantabria?

Absolutely. Many easy trails in Cantabria are perfect for families. The Arroyo de la Llana River Trail offers a gentle path along a river, ideal for a relaxed family outing. The Nansa River Trail, mentioned in regional research, is also known for being suitable for families and beginners, winding through lush forests.

Are there easy coastal walks with scenic views?

Cantabria's coastline provides numerous easy walks with stunning views. The Liencres Dunes Coastal Trail offers panoramic views of the Cantabrian Sea, featuring coastal dunes and beaches. Another excellent choice is the Comillas Coastal Route, which leads through picturesque coastal scenery.

What kind of natural features can I expect to see on easy hikes in Cantabria?

Easy hikes in Cantabria showcase a rich variety of natural features. You can explore coastal dunes and beaches along routes like the Liencres Dunes Coastal Trail, or discover riverine landscapes on the Arroyo de la Llana River Trail. The region also features lush valleys, dramatic cliffs, and unique areas like the Redwood Forest in Monte Cabezón, offering a distinctive hiking experience.

Are there any easy trails near significant natural parks or attractions?

Yes, many easy trails are close to significant natural areas. For instance, the Lebaniego Way follows a historic pilgrimage path through varied Cantabrian landscapes, often passing through areas near the Picos de Europa. You can also find trails near coastal parks like Oyambre Natural Park, known for its well-preserved coastline, estuaries, and dunes.

What are some interesting landmarks or points of interest along easy trails?

Along easy trails in Cantabria, you can encounter various points of interest. Coastal routes might offer views of historic lighthouses, while inland paths could lead you past traditional villages or natural monuments. For example, you might find yourself near Oyambre Natural Park or the Santoña, Victoria and Joyel Marshes Natural Park, both offering unique natural beauty.

Are there easy hikes that include waterfalls?

While specific easy trails with prominent waterfalls are not detailed in the provided routes, the Asón Nature Park is regionally known for its dramatic waterfalls and dense forests. If you're seeking waterfalls, exploring trails within or near this park would be a good starting point, though some may be more challenging than 'easy'.

What is the best time of year for easy hiking in Cantabria?

Cantabria offers good hiking conditions for easy trails thro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n provide p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ery, while summer is ideal for coastal walks. Even winter can be suitable for lower-elevation easy trails, though higher mountain areas might require specific gear or be inaccessible.

Are there any easy trails that offer views of the Picos de Europa?

While many easy trails are at lower elevations, some routes in Cantabria can offer distant views of the majestic Picos de Europa, especially coastal paths on clear days. The region's unique geography means you can often see the mountains from various vantage points, even on easier walks.

Are there easy trails that are accessible by public transport?

Cantabria's public transport network connects many towns and villages, making some trailheads accessible. While specific public transport details for each easy route are not listed, researching local bus routes to popular coastal towns like Comillas or San Vicente de la Barquera, or to the starting points of river trails, can help you find accessible options.
